The Pros and Cons of MACS Facelift in Calgary In the pursuit of maintaining a youthful and rejuvenated appearance, many individuals in Calgary are turning to the MACS (Minimal Access Cranial Suspension) facelift procedure. This minimally invasive surgical technique has gained popularity for its ability to address the signs of aging without the extensive downtime associated with traditional facelift surgery. As with any cosmetic procedure, it is essential to weigh the potential benefits and drawbacks before making a decision. In this article, we will explore the pros and cons of the MACS facelift in Calgary.

The Pros of MACS Facelift in Calgary

1. Minimal Scarring: The MACS facelift technique involves smaller incisions compared to a traditional facelift, resulting in less visible scarring. This can be particularly appealing for individuals who are self-conscious about the appearance of scars. 2. Shorter Recovery Time: The MACS procedure is less invasive, allowing for a quicker recovery period. Patients can typically return to their normal activities within 1-2 weeks, rather than the 2-4 weeks typically required for a traditional facelift. 3. Natural-Looking Results: The MACS facelift aims to achieve a more natural and refreshed appearance by lifting and tightening the skin without significantly altering the overall facial features. This can help patients avoid the "pulled" or "stretched" look that can sometimes occur with more extensive facelift procedures. 4. Targeted Improvement: The MACS technique allows for more precise targeting of specific areas of concern, such as the jawline, neck, and cheeks, without the need to address the entire face. 5. Reduced Risk of Complications: Due to the minimally invasive nature of the MACS facelift, the risk of complications, such as infection, hematoma, and nerve damage, is generally lower compared to traditional facelift surgery.

The Cons of MACS Facelift in Calgary

1. Limited Improvements: While the MACS facelift can address moderate signs of aging, it may not be as effective as a traditional facelift in addressing more significant sagging, excess skin, or deep wrinkles. Patients with more advanced aging may require a more comprehensive surgical approach. 2. Potential for Revision Surgery: In some cases, the results of a MACS facelift may not last as long as a traditional facelift, and patients may need to undergo revision surgery or additional procedures to maintain their desired appearance. 3. Cost: The MACS facelift procedure can be more expensive than non-surgical anti-aging treatments, such as neurotoxin injections or dermal fillers. Patients should consider their budget and long-term goals when deciding on the best option. 4. Swelling and Bruising: While the recovery time is generally shorter than a traditional facelift, patients may still experience some swelling and bruising in the weeks following the procedure, which can impact their appearance during the healing process.

FAQ

1. **How long does a MACS facelift procedure take?** The MACS facelift procedure typically takes 2-3 hours to complete, depending on the complexity of the case and the specific areas being addressed. 2. **How long do the results of a MACS facelift last?** The results of a MACS facelift can last for 5-10 years, depending on the individual's skin quality, age, and lifestyle factors. Some patients may require touch-up procedures or additional treatments to maintain their desired appearance over time. 3. **Is the MACS facelift procedure painful?** The MACS facelift is performed under general anesthesia, so patients do not experience any pain during the procedure. However, there may be some discomfort and swelling during the recovery period, which can typically be managed with pain medication and proper aftercare. 4. **Can the MACS facelift be combined with other procedures?** Yes, the MACS facelift can be combined with other cosmetic procedures, such as eyelid surgery, brow lift, or neck lift, to achieve a more comprehensive facial rejuvenation.
